Kinds of Urns
Classic Cremation Urns: These urns typically reflect timeless styles that are both timeless and graceful. They are available in a wide range of substances such as wood, brass, marble, and ceramic. Many families in the UK opt for these classic selections for their understated design and elegant appearance, suitable for showing in the home or at a memorial service.

Keepsake Urns: For those who wish to divide a fraction of the ashes among loved ones, keepsake urns are a perfect option. These small urns let loved ones to individually hold onto a meaningful fraction of the ashes, providing a intimate keepsake that can be treasured for years to come. Keepsake urns are available in a variety of patterns, allowing each person to pick something that resonates with them.

Ashes Vessels, Pots, and Vases: For a more modern look, ashes vessels, pots, and vases give a unique take on the classic urn. With streamlined designs and modern appearance, these urns can effortlessly blend into the home while holding a important purpose.

Factors When Selecting an Urn
When choosing an urn for ashes, take into account the capacity and type. Urns come in different sizes based on whether they will store the entire amount of ashes or a small part for keepsake purposes. You’ll also have to reflect on where the urn will be stored – whether shown at home, set in a memorial garden, or kept in a special location.

The substance of the urn is Ashes Urns UK another essential factor. Wooden urns provide a natural feel, while metal urns provide durability and elegance. For those wanting a more artistic touch, ceramic and glass urns can act as stunning works of art that represent the distinctiveness of your family member.
